The Authenticity Paradox and the Perils of Youth Marketing

As a veteran of youth counterculture, I’m watching with curiosity the growing importance of youth voices as a gauge for the so-called “real,” not in the philosophical sense, but in the “keeping it real” sense. Marketers are not concerned whether or not adults think what they see is “real”: it’s the skeptical teen audience that is more challenging.
